DIRECTIONS

Chef's Chocolate Salty Balls

1.

Place a stick of butter, cubed, into a the bowl of a stand mixer with 2 cups of sugar, and mix on high for 2 minutes. Crack 3 whole eggs and cream together with the butter and sugar on a high speed until creamy.

of butter, cubed

1 stick of butter, cubed

sugar

2 cups sugar

eggs

3 whole eggs

2.

In a separate bowl, combine 1 cup of flour, ½ cup of unsweetened cocoa powder, and 1 ½ tsp each of baking powder and kosher salt. Whisk together before slowly adding to the mixture in the stand mixture on a low speed.

flour

1 cup flour

unsweetened cocoa powder

½ cup unsweetened cocoa powder

baking powder

1 ½ tsp baking powder

kosher salt

1 ½ tsp kosher salt

3.

As that comes together we’re going to add ½ tsp vanilla extract, ½ cup buttermilk, and ¼ cup vegetable oil.

vanilla extract

½ tsp vanilla extract

buttermilk

½ cup buttermilk

vegetable oil

¼ cup vegetable oil

4.

Once those are added, turn mixer back on to a high speed for 2-3 minutes or until light and fluffy.

5.

Oil the inside of a cake pan, fill it with the cake batter, smooth out the top, and bake at 350°F for 35-40 minutes or until set and no longer jiggling.

6.

While cake cools, we’re going to melt 8 ounces of chocolate in a double boiler. Pour chocolate onto a sheet pan and spread it out until smooth. Freeze for 10 minutes or until it has lost its sheen.

chocolate

8 ounces chocolate

7.

Use a lemon zester, scrape the chocolate off of the pan, creating some short and curly chocolate curls. Place in a bowl and toss with some cocoa powder. Place in freezer until we’re ready to use them.

8.

In the meantime we’re going to scrape our cooled cake into a mixing bowl. Adding ½ cup of whole milk, adding more milk if necessary until we reach a dough-y consistency. We will then shape them into chocolate balls and place on a parchment lined baking sheet.

whole milk

½ cup whole milk

9.

Coat balls in molten chocolate and roll in the bowl of chocolate curlies.

Pork Stew

1.

Start by removing seeds and stems from chilies and cut them into 1 inch pieces. Place into dry fry pan and toast on a medium high heat until smoking slightly and fragrant.

Cascabella chiles

Cascabella chiles

Guajillo chiles

Guajillo chiles

Ancho chiles

Ancho chiles

2.

While pan is still hot add chicken stock and bring to a bare simmer, cover and remove from heat and allow to steep for about 30 minutes.

chicken stock

1 ½ cups chicken stock

3.

Place the pepper mixture in the bowl of a food processor and pulse a few times before adding corn flour for thickening, dried oregano, unsweetened cocoa powder, and ground cumin. Process that for about 2 minutes or until smooth.

corn flour

½ cup corn flour

dried oregano

1 tbsp dried oregano

unsweetened cocoa powder

2 tbsp unsweetened cocoa powder

ground cumin

1 tbsp ground cumin

4.

In a separate bowl, combine finely chopped habanero, finely chopped jalapeno, chopped onion and garlic, and set aside.

habanero

1 habanero

jalapeno

1 jalapeno

onion

1 onion

of garlic

1 clove of garlic

5.

Take boneless pork shoulder and cut into ½-inch pieces along with squeezing a pound of uncured chorizo out of it’s casing.

Boneless pork shoulder

Boneless pork shoulder

of uncured chorizo

1 pound of uncured chorizo

6.

Brown the chorizo over a medium high heat, rendering out all the fat, and breaking into small pieces. Remove chorizo and add pork shoulder to the brown in the sausage fat.

7.

Remove pork shoulder and add our chopped vegetables. Once vegetables are cooked, deglaze with a full Mexican beer.

Mexican beer

1 Mexican beer

8.

Scrape all the good stuff off the bottom of the pot, add our spice paste, another chicken stock, and canned of chopped tomatoes, along with our meat back into the pot.

chicken stock

1 ½ cups chicken stock

14oz of chopped tomatoes

2 14oz of chopped tomatoes

9.

Stir and partially cover and let simmer for 3-4 hours on a low heat until meat is fully cooked and the sauce is thickened. Add salt and pepper for taste.

Salt

Salt

Pepper

Pepper

10.

Serve with cheddar cheese and chives. Enjoy!

Cheddar cheese

Cheddar cheese

Chives

Chives
